Output 527e75ba85a6239606d193478eaa4d8004625252d47ea6672b24242d5f256e3f:0

value
51105426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3835e362126ef224057d5139a3f4959f3924f8da OP_EQUAL
address
MD2NdPfLrjq4NHeaqYYoeP9cTZaKoLd7Xz
transaction
527e75ba85a6239606d193478eaa4d8004625252d47ea6672b24242d5f256e3f
spent
true